    • Primary Care Short Course on Chronic Cough

      Event date and time: 8 November 2024, 2:00pm to 4:30pm

      Online: Microsoft Teams

      Event description:

      We invite you to the KHP Cardiovascular & Respiratory Partnership Programme's Primary Care Short Course on Chronic Cough. The main aim of this course is to provide a primary care update on diagnosis, management, and common pitfalls in planning care for patients with chronic cough.

      The course will be held virtually via Teams and is open to all, but may be of particular interest to primary care multidisciplinary teams, especially GP Nurses, Pharmacists, and GPs.

    • KHP Centre for Translational Medicine PPIE Training Workshop

      Event date and time: 12 November 2024, 2:00pm to 5:00pm

      Venue tbc

      Event description:

      You are invited to the upcoming Patient and Public Involvement/ Engagement (PPIE) Training workshop. This is an in-person event.
       
      By attending this training, we aim for you to be able to:
      •    Increase understanding of the importance of patient and public involvement in research;
      •    Brainstorm innovative methods for public involvement at each stage of the research process;
      •    Develop skills in reporting and evaluating public involvement which can be used in grant applications and publications.
